Education
Bachelor of Science in Engineering, Gonzaga U., 1961; Juris Doctor, Gonzaga U., 1966.

Assistant city attorney, City of Tacoma (Washington), 1967-1969; judge pro tem, Municipal Court and Pierce County District Court, 1971-1980; partner, Tanner & Burgess, Tacoma, Washington, 1971-1976; partner, Tanner, McGavick, Felker, Fleming, Burgess & Lazares, Tacoma, Washington, 1976-1979; partner, McGavick, Burgess, Heller & Foister, Tacoma, Washington, 1979-1980; regional counsel, Department Housing and Urban Development, Seattle, 1980-1981; United States magistrate judge, United States District Court (western district) Washington, 1981-1993; district judge, United States Court Appeals (9th circuit), Tacoma, Washington, since 1994.

Member Washington State Bar Association, Pierce County Bar Association, Loren Miller BarAssn., National Conference United States Magistrate Judges, National Association for the Advancement of Colored People.
